How much does it cost to rent a home in Sixes Crossing?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sixes Crossing 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,783 | $1,350 | $2,000 |
| Sixes Crossing 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,289 | $1,745 | $5,450 |
| Sixes Crossing 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,615 | $2,065 | $5,750 |
| Sixes Crossing 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,132 | $2,275 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sixes Crossing
What type of rentals are currently available in Sixes Crossing?
There are currently 19 Apartments for Rent in Sixes Crossing, GA with pricing that ranges from $1,018 to $3,205. There are also 101 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sixes Crossing ranging from $1,350 to $10,750.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sixes Crossing?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sixes Crossing ranges from $1,350 to $10,750 with an average monthly rent of $2,499.
